A facilities management company in Edinburgh is seeking a Facilities Engineer to ensure safe working conditions and maintain HVAC, electrical, and life safety systems. The position requires experience in technical fields, problem-solving abilities, and the capacity to work unsupervised.
Candidates must possess relevant trade qualifications, a valid driving license, and a minimum of three years of experience in similar roles. The role emphasizes safety compliance and teamwork while offering opportunities for professional development.

How to prepare for a job interview at ATALIAN SERVEST
✨Know Your Technical Stuff
Make sure you brush up on your HVAC and BMS knowledge before the interview. Be ready to discuss specific systems you've worked with and any challenges you've faced. This will show that you’re not just familiar with the basics but can also handle real-world problems.
✨Safety First!
Since safety compliance is a big deal in this role, be prepared to talk about your experience with safety protocols. Think of examples where you ensured safe working conditions or dealt with safety issues. This will demonstrate your commitment to maintaining a safe environment.
✨Show Off Your Problem-Solving Skills
Prepare some examples of how you've tackled technical problems in the past.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your answers. This will help you clearly convey your thought process and how you approach challenges.
✨Team Player Vibes
Even though the role requires working unsupervised, teamwork is still key. Be ready to share experiences where you collaborated with others or contributed to a team project. Highlighting your ability to work well with colleagues will make you stand out as a candidate.
